UV400 Sunglasses Testing Before Bulk Shipment

This guide is for brands, importers, distributors, and retailers buying custom sunglasses in volume. It explains how to verify UV400 protection before bulk shipment, not after cartons reach your warehouse. The goal is simple: stronger compliance files, cleaner retail claims, fewer rejected lots, and fewer disputes with suppliers, inspectors, retailers, or marketplace compliance teams.
Start With What UV400 Means
UV400 is a protection claim. It means the lens is intended to block ultraviolet radiation up to 400 nm, covering UVA and UVB wavelengths. For buyers, that claim must match the ultraviolet transmittance limits required by the test method and destination market. Your purchase order should state both UV400 and the relevant standard, such as EN ISO 12312-1, ANSI Z80.3, or AS/NZS 1067.
UV400 is not lens darkness. A dark category 3 lens may look protective and still fail if the lens material, absorber, coating, or film structure is wrong. A light amber, clear fashion, or category 1 lens may pass UV400 if the material and coating system are controlled. Do not approve bulk production based only on a hangtag, website claim, catalog page, or supplier sales sheet. Test the lens.
At factory level, UV performance depends on lens material, absorber additives, tinting process, coating stack, polarization film, adhesive layers, and rework control. PC lenses can provide strong UV blocking when the resin grade and additives are correct. TAC polarized lenses depend on film structure, adhesive layers, and supplier consistency. Nylon can perform well for sports and curved lenses when the grade is properly specified. CR39 can provide good optical quality but usually requires controlled material selection, tinting, and coating. The frame material, whether acetate, TR90, metal, or recycled plastic, does not create UV protection. The lens does.
Buyer rule: treat UV400 as a safety and labeling claim that must be verified by lens type and production batch, not as a decoration claim.
Ask for a Report That Matches the Order
A useful UV400 report is specific. It should identify the lens material, lens color, coating or polarization status, test method, tested wavelength range, test date, sample quantity, and result. For shipment approval, the report should connect to the actual order by SKU, color code, model, product family, production date, supplier batch number, or another traceable reference.
A generic report with no model, no color, and no batch link may help with early supplier screening. It is weak evidence for a finished retail shipment. Ask the supplier or laboratory to provide measured results across the relevant UV range, not only a single word such as "pass." For regulated retail channels, the claimed lens category, UV protection, polarization status, warnings, and compliance mark should match the product packed in cartons.
| Document | What It Should Confirm | Buyer Check |
|---|---|---|
| UV transmission report | Blocking performance up to 400 nm | Match lens color, material, treatment, and batch |
| EN ISO 12312-1 / CE file | EU sunglass performance and labeling basis | Confirm model or product family coverage |
| ANSI Z80.3 | U.S. non-prescription sunglass requirements | Check optical, UV, and traffic-signal sections where relevant |
| AS/NZS 1067 | Australia and New Zealand sunglass requirements | Confirm lens category, warnings, and labeling |
| REACH review | Restricted substance control | Review frame, lens, coating, paint, logo, pouch, and packaging scope |

The value is not a logo on a PDF. The value is whether the document covers the product, lens construction, labeling claim, and production batch used for your order.
Set Batch Sampling Before Production
Agree on sampling rules before deposit. Do not negotiate them during final inspection. UV400 checks are faster than many full laboratory programs, but they still need to represent the actual bulk lenses. For a small trial order, test finished pairs from each lens color or treatment. For larger programs, build UV checks into incoming lens inspection, first production output, and final random finished-goods QC.
A practical three-stage plan works well. First, test or verify the approved pre-production sample. Second, test lenses or assembled frames from the first mass production run before the full batch is packed. Third, test random finished goods before cartons are sealed and released.
- Record SKU, frame color, lens color, lens material, supplier batch number, and production date.
- Test both left and right lenses after assembly, especially on curved, oversized, or highly wrapped frames.
- Separate polarized, mirror, gradient, photochromic, and clear-lens variants as different test groups.
- Keep at least one retained sample per tested lens batch at the factory or buyer office.
- Photograph the test reading with the product, PO number, and carton or batch reference visible.
For cosmetic defects, many buyers use AQL sampling or their own retailer standard for scratches, frame alignment, hinge function, printing drift, lens fit, and packaging damage. That is useful. It is not a substitute for UV verification. A pair can look perfect and still fail the UV claim.
Match Lens Material, Color, and Category
Check UV400 together with visible light transmission category. Category 3 lenses are common for strong sunlight. Category 0 or 1 fashion lenses may still block UV400, but they should not be marketed as dark sun lenses. Category 4 lenses require specific warnings and are generally not suitable for driving. If the hangtag says UV400, polarized, category 3, and CE, every claim needs support from the specification, test record, and packed product.
Material behavior matters. PC is common for promotional, sports, and children's sunglasses because it is impact resistant and can support UV-blocking performance when the material grade is controlled. TAC polarized lenses are common for lifestyle and driving-oriented polarized orders, but film consistency and lamination quality must be checked. Nylon is useful for premium curved sports lenses because it can support shape stability and optical performance when properly processed. CR39 can provide good optical quality, but it is less impact resistant than PC and requires controlled coating and tinting.
| Lens Type | Typical Use | UV400 Control Point |
|---|---|---|
| PC | Sports, kids, promotional, durable programs | Confirm resin grade, additive consistency, and coating after tinting |
| TAC polarized | Driving, beach, fishing, lifestyle polarized lines | Test UV blocking and polarization efficiency by color and film batch |
| Nylon | Curved sports, premium lightweight styles | Check optical distortion, curve stability, and UV performance after forming |
| CR39 | Fashion and optical-quality sun lenses | Control tint depth, coating adhesion, and UV absorber specification |
Color changes create compliance risk. If a buyer approves smoke gray and later switches to gradient brown, mirror blue, or pink transparent lenses, the old UV report may not cover the new production. For gradient lenses, test the lightest zone, not only the darkest top area. For mirror lenses, confirm UV protection through testing. Reflective appearance proves nothing.
Control Decoration and Label Claims Separately
Custom sunglasses often include laser engraving, pad printing, hot stamping, metal logo plates, temple plaques, lens logos, printed pouches, barcodes, and retail hangtags. These decoration steps usually do not change UV blocking by themselves. They do create claim risk when the wrong tag, pouch, barcode, or sticker is applied to the wrong lens group.

This can help traceability when production records connect frame production, lens cutting, logo application, and packing. The buyer still needs a locked specification sheet. It should include lens material, thickness, color code, polarization status, UV400 requirement, lens category, logo method, logo position tolerance, approved sample reference, packaging wording, warning text, barcode data, and carton marks.
Use measurable decoration tolerances. For temple printing, define the acceptable position tolerance in writing and compare it with the approved sample. For laser logos on lenses, require the mark to stay outside the wearer's main field of vision and match the approved sample. For metal plates, check adhesion, edge smoothness, corrosion resistance, and whether plating or coating materials are included in the chemical compliance review.
Keep two approvals separate: decoration approval and UV approval. A clean logo does not prove the lens is compliant. A passing UV lens does not excuse inaccurate packaging, missing warnings, or unsupported retail claims.
Watch the Process Points That Break UV Protection
Many UV failures come from substitutions or uncontrolled changes. A lens supplier changes sheet stock. A tint formula is adjusted to hit a color target. A rework batch is mixed with approved lenses. A buyer requests a lower price and the lens grade changes without written approval. These are avoidable risks.
A custom eyewear production line may include injection molding, acetate cutting, CNC milling, hinge fitting, lens cutting, tinting, coating, decoration, assembly, cleaning, and packing. Each step needs traceability. Incoming lens sheets or blanks should be labeled by supplier, material, color, batch, and date. Cut lenses should remain separated by SKU and treatment. Reworked lenses should not be mixed back into approved stock without retesting and written release.
Price pressure needs specification control. Cost reductions should come from scale, tooling efficiency, simplified decoration, packaging optimization, or specification alignment. They should not come from unapproved lens substitution.
If the factory proposes a material, lens supplier, tint, coating, or polarization change to meet a target price or delivery date, require written approval and new UV verification before bulk production continues. Apply the same rule to changes from PC to TAC, non-polarized to polarized, solid tint to gradient, standard lens to mirror coating, or one lens color to another.
Inspect the Right Items During Final QC
Final QC should confirm that the product in the carton matches the approved sample, written specification, and compliance claim. This is not only a laboratory issue. Inspectors can catch many problems with a clear checklist and a calibrated or verified portable UV transmission tester. Laboratory testing still matters for formal compliance files, retailer submissions, or disputed results.
| Checkpoint | Method | Fail Signal |
|---|---|---|
| UV400 function | Portable UV tester or lab report review | Any lens reads outside the agreed limit or range |
| Lens category | Visible transmission test or document review | Hangtag category does not match lens darkness |
| Lens mix control | Compare SKU, color, batch, and carton marks | Different lens batches packed under one SKU without traceability |
| Polarization | Polarization test card or instrument check | Weak, uneven, or missing polarization effect |
| Logo and decoration | Visual check against approval sample | Laser, pad print, plate, or temple logo placement drift |
| Retail packaging | Read hangtag, pouch, barcode, and carton label | UV400, CE, ANSI, polarized, or category claim missing or overclaimed |
For retail-ready orders, check packaging language line by line. Do not use one universal hangtag across all lens types unless every product using that tag meets every claim on it. If one SKU is category 3 polarized and another is category 1 fashion tint, they should not share the same claim set unless the wording is accurate for both.

Build final inspection time into that window. Rushing inspection at the end of production increases the risk of wrong lens mixes, missing warning labels, unsupported UV400 claims, and packaging errors.
Use UV400 as a Shipment Release Condition
The safest workflow is straightforward: lock the approved sample, lock the written specification, verify first production output, inspect finished goods, then release shipment. Document changes before production continues, especially for lens material, lens color, polarization, coating, labeling, or destination market.
Before bulk shipment, ask for a shipment file. It should include the final invoice SKU list, packing list, production photos, QC report, UV test record, applicable compliance documents, and photos of retail packaging. If the order has several lens colors or treatments, the file should separate them. A single mixed report for black, brown, green, clear, gradient, and mirrored lenses is weak unless it clearly identifies and covers each variant.
- Product scope: SKU, frame material, lens material, lens color, polarization, and decoration method.
- UV requirement: UV400 protection tested up to 400 nm with batch traceability.
- Market standard: EN ISO 12312-1, ANSI Z80.3, or AS/NZS 1067 based on destination.
- Chemical file: REACH review where frame, lens, coating, print, pouch, and packaging are relevant.
- Sampling plan: approved sample, first production check, and final finished-goods spot check.
- Label control: approved wording for UV400, polarized, lens category, warnings, and compliance marks.
If you are buying 50 pairs for a test launch, keep the process light but still test the actual lenses. If you are buying higher-volume production, require batch-level records, variant-level traceability, and retained samples. The cost of checking is usually small compared with relabeling, airfreight replacement, chargebacks, or a retailer compliance dispute.
Best practice: make UV400 verification a shipment release condition in the PO, not a request after cartons are packed.

Frequently asked questions
Is a UV400 sticker enough for customs or retail compliance? No. A sticker is only a product claim. Ask for a UV transmission report tied to the lens material, color, treatment, and production batch, plus the relevant market standard such as EN ISO 12312-1, ANSI Z80.3, or AS/NZS 1067. Also check that the claim appears correctly on the hangtag, packaging, and SKU file.
Do darker sunglasses always give better UV protection? No. Darkness controls visible light transmission, not automatic UV blocking. A light lens can pass UV400 if the material or coating blocks UV properly, while a dark lens can fail if the absorber, coating, film, or material grade is wrong. Test UV performance separately from lens category.
Should every lens color be tested separately? Yes, unless the report clearly covers the exact product family, color range, treatments, and production batch. Treat gradient, mirror, polarized, clear fashion, and photochromic lenses as separate test groups. For gradient lenses, test the lightest area because it may be the highest-risk zone.
When should UV testing happen in a custom sunglasses order? Use three checkpoints: approved sample, first mass production output, and random finished goods before shipment. For LumiShades orders, samples usually take 7-10 days and bulk production usually takes 25-35 days after approval, so the testing plan should be included in the production schedule before deposit.
What should I do if final inspection finds one UV failure? Hold shipment for the affected SKU, lens color, or batch. Retest additional samples, separate suspect lens lots, check whether labels or lens batches were mixed, and compare results with the approved sample and test report. Release cartons only after replacement, verified rework, or documented retesting confirms the claim.
